> It looks like a new field type "passkey" was added in the KSM vault, and whenever a record is edited in the vault, it may add this new field, which blows up the attempt to fetch records using the KSM SDK with the following error:
> {code:java}
> kotlinx.serialization.json.internal.JsonDecodingException: Polymorphic serializer was not found for class discriminator 'passkey'
> JSON input: {"type":"passkey","value":[]}

> Thankfully, it looks like support for the new "passkey" field type was added in the 16.5.3 version of the SDK, so fixing this should hopefully be as easy as updating the KSM SDK version:
